Effects of tourism development on economic growth: An empirical study of China based on both static and dynamic spatial Durbin models

Abstract: This study applies the dynamic spatial Durbin model (SDM) to explore the direct and spillover effects of tourism development on economic growth from the perspective of domestic and inbound tourism. The results are compared with those from the static SDM. The results support the tourism-led-economic-growth hypothesis in China. Specifically, domestic tourism and inbound tourism play a significant role in stimulating local economic growth. However, the spatial spillover effect is limited to domestic tourism, and … Show more

“…Since the improvement of the educational level of regional human resources is beneficial for exerting knowledge spillover effects, it is supposed that this factor is positively related to industrial convergence. Drawing on the research conducted by Liu et al [67], Croes et al [68], and Liu et al [69], this article adopted the human resources/labor force (LABOURit) as a control variable, taking the number of education years per capita as a proxy variable. The calculation method was as follows: (Sample population with primary school education × 6 + population with junior high school education × 9 + population with high school education × 12 + population with college degree and above × 16) ÷ total sample population of six years old and more.…”

“…In recent years, the tourism industry has been regarded as one of the strategic pillar industries of the Chinese national economy, partially because it exerts an increasingly important impetus to promote economic growth and increase employment [ 1 , 2 ]. According to data from of the Ministry of Culture and Tourism of the People’s Republic of China, the number of domestic tourist arrivals reached 6.0 billion in 2019, an increase of 8.4%, and the total tourism revenue reached 961.3 billion USD, an annual increase of 11%.…”
